Synopsis "Wireless Telegraphy"

"Wireless Telegraphy" (1915) offers a detailed exploration of the principles and practical applications of early radio technology. Authored by Jonathan Adolf Wilhelm Zenneck and translated by Alfred E. Seelig, this book serves as an invaluable resource for understanding the scientific underpinnings and engineering feats of wireless communication during the early 20th century.The text delves into the theoretical foundations of electromagnetic waves, the design and operation of transmitters and receivers, and the various methods of wireless signaling. It provides insights into the historical context of wireless telegraphy, highlighting its pivotal role in maritime communication, military operations, and the burgeoning field of broadcasting.
